Description

2-Amino-4-Bromo-3-Chloropyridine is a high-purity halogenated pyridine derivative serving as a critical building block in advanced organic synthesis. Its value lies in its multifunctional reactivity, where the amino, bromo, and chloro substituents provide distinct handles for selective cross-coupling and substitution reactions. This compound is essential for researchers and manufacturers in the pharmaceutical and agrochemical industries developing novel active ingredients and complex molecular architectures.

Application

  • Pharmaceutical Intermediate: A key precursor in the synthesis of active pharmaceutical ingredients (APIs), particularly for kinase inhibitors and other small-molecule therapeutics.
  • Agrochemical Synthesis: Used in the development of modern pesticides and herbicides, leveraging its halogenated structure for bioactivity.
  • Material Science Research: Serves as a monomer or functionalizing agent in the creation of specialized polymers and organic electronic materials.
  • Ligand and Catalyst Development: Employed to construct complex nitrogen-containing ligands for transition metal catalysis.
  • Chemical Biology Probes: Utilized in the design and synthesis of molecular probes for studying biological pathways and target engagement.
  • Custom Synthesis and R&D: A versatile scaffold for contract research organizations and discovery chemists exploring new chemical spaces.

Basic Information

Product Name 2-Amino-4-Bromo-3-Chloropyridine
CAS No. 861024-02-4
Molecular Formula C5H4BrClN2
Molecular Weight 207.46 g/mol
Synonyms 4-Bromo-3-chloro-2-pyridinamine; 3-Chloro-4-bromo-2-aminopyridine; 2-Pyridinamine, 4-bromo-3-chloro-; 4-Bromo-3-chloropyridin-2-amine; 2-Amino-3-chloro-4-bromopyridine; 4-Bromo-3-chloro-2-aminopyridine; AB3CP

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ated place at a controlled room temperature (15-25°C). This material is hygroscopic (moisture-sensitive); keep the container tightly sealed in a dry environment to prevent degradation.

Specification

Item Specification
Appearance White to off-white crystalline powder
Identification (IR) Conforms to structure
Purity (HPLC) ≥ 98.0%
Loss on Drying ≤ 0.5%
Residue on Ignition ≤ 0.1%
Heavy Metals ≤ 20 ppm
